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14473083 761351 211 331
6551354531 025555785
6551354531 025555785
03011621 10182639 055 83726595
All about undefined
Interested in learning more?
6551354531 025555785
03011621 10182639 055 83726595
See more
82419102518 90649 63230
5277437953 8198 990 96304 708719
See more
17 37716152451
821 22308 327507
See more